Understanding Deposit and Withdrawal Limits

Deposit Limits: Keeping Your Spending in Check

Most online casinos have deposit limits. These are usually set to help you manage your bankroll and prevent overspending. They can be daily, weekly, or monthly. Some casinos allow you to set your own deposit limits, which is a great way to stay in control. Always check the casino’s policy on deposit limits before you start playing. This information is usually found in the “Terms and Conditions” or “Banking” section of the website.

Withdrawal Limits: How Much, and How Often?

Withdrawal limits are just as important. These dictate how much money you can withdraw at a time, and how often you can make withdrawals. Some casinos have daily, weekly, or monthly withdrawal limits. Others might have different limits depending on the payment method you choose. High rollers might look for casinos with higher withdrawal limits, but for beginners, it’s more important to understand the limits and make sure they fit your needs. Also, pay attention to the minimum withdrawal amount. You’ll need to have at least that much in your account to cash out.

Bonus Conditions: The Fine Print of Free Money

Bonuses are a big draw for online casinos. They can include welcome bonuses, free spins, and reload bonuses. However, these bonuses almost always come with conditions attached. Understanding these conditions is crucial to avoid disappointment. Here are some key things to look out for:

  • Wagering Requirements: This is probably the most important condition.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, specify how many times you need to wager the bonus amount (or sometimes the bonus plus the deposit amount) before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a 20x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means you need to wager $2,000 before you can cash out.
  • Game Restrictions: Not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Some games might contribute 100% (like slots), while others might contribute less (like table games), or not at all. Always check which games are eligible and how much they contribute.
  • Time Limits: Bonuses often have expiration dates. You’ll need to meet the wagering requirements within a specific timeframe, or the bonus and any winnings will be forfeited.
  • Maximum Bet Limits: Some bonuses have maximum bet limits. This means you can’t bet more than a certain amount per spin or hand while playing with bonus funds.

Payment Methods and Processing Times

The payment method you choose can significantly impact withdrawal times. Different methods have different processing times. E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ller often offer the fastest withdrawals. Bank transfers and credit/debit cards usually take longer. Before you sign up, check the casino’s accepted payment methods and their associated processing times. Look for casinos that offer a variety of options to suit your needs.

Verification Procedures: Proving You’re You

Online casinos are required to verify your identity to comply with regulations and prevent fraud. This usually involves submitting documents like a copy of your driver’s license or passport, and proof of address (like a utility bill). This process is standard and helps ensure the security of your account. Be prepared to provide these documents when requested. The sooner you complete the verification process, the faster you can withdraw your winnings.
